WebHá 4 horas · Norovirus is the most common of several viruses that cause severe gastrointestinal illness or acute gastroenteritis. Symptoms may include diarrhea and … WebHá 6 horas · In the U.S., norovirus causes 19–21 million cases of vomiting and diarrhea illnesses annually, according to data from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C). Norovirus also kills about 900 people—mostly adults 65 or older—and causes 109,000 hospitalizations each year.

Web28 de abr. de 2024 · Symptoms. A rotavirus infection usually starts within two days of exposure to the virus. Early symptoms are a fever and vomiting, followed by three to seven days of watery diarrhea. The infection can cause abdominal pain as well.
